Biometric Residence Permit for all settlement route Applicants
Here's the latest update link from UKVI called
Get a biometric residence permit (BRP)
Please do take time to read the Guidance which is linked under the made webpage link given above.
It's an important change to the BRP process, especially to those living outside the UK and making their application for settlement route visa's
Please be sure you read all and follow all appropriate links before requesting clarifications

The new Biometric Residence Permits (BRPs) process rolled out from 31 May 2015 for applicants in the Philippines travelling to the UK for more than six months.
Please follow this link for the announcement detail.
I'd guess that Rhosalie submitted her application before 31 May 2015 ?

Phil,
I'm no longer registered with OISC so I don't get updated on new stuff anymore.
But I believe that a replacement 30 day Travel Vignette is dealt with under Transfer of Conditions
The cost is around the £70-£90 mark
Your letter will detail.
Give or take a little time it shouldn't be too difficult to manage unless there are some time consuming issues to take care of. Most folks on here seem to fly to UK fairly soon after the visa decision.
It does mean compromising on short-time decisions but using the UKVI processing times to determine a reasonable travel date should work out reasonably well.
